工控网首页
>

应用设计

>

如何快速的掌握wincc的脚本功能的学习方法?

如何快速的掌握wincc的脚本功能的学习方法?

2024/6/4 15:06:50

WinCC(Windows Control Center)是西门子公司推出的一款工业控制软件。它的脚本功能强大,可以大大提升系统的自动化程度和灵活性。然而,对于初学者来说,掌握WinCC的脚本功能可能是一项挑战。本文将介绍两种有效的方法,帮助你快速掌握WinCC的脚本功能。

方法一:从高频功能入手

1. 读写变量

在WinCC脚本中,读写变量是最基本的操作。通过脚本,可以读取或修改PLC中的变量,从而实现人机界面的实时数据交互。例如,可以通过脚本读取温度传感器的数据,并在界面上显示;或者通过脚本修改PLC中的某个开关变量,控制现场设备的启停。

1.png

2. 置位、复位、取反

置位、复位和取反操作是WinCC脚本中常用的功能,尤其在控制逻辑中非常重要。通过置位可以将某个变量设为True,复位可以将其设为False,而取反则将变量的当前值反转。

2.png

3. 数学运算

WinCC脚本支持各种数学运算,可以用于数据处理和逻辑判断。例如,可以通过脚本计算两个传感器的平均值,并根据计算结果进行相应的控制。

3.png

4. Excel 读写

WinCC脚本还可以实现与Excel的交互功能,这对于数据记录和报表生成非常有用。例如,可以通过脚本将采集到的数据写入Excel文件,或者从Excel文件读取配置参数。

4.png

方法二:借助官方手册

官方手册是学习WinCC脚本功能的重要资源。它不仅包含详细的功能说明,还有大量的示例代码,可以帮助你快速理解和应用各种脚本功能。

1. 建立学习欲望和信心

快速上手的目的不仅是掌握基础功能,更重要的是建立起学习的欲望和信心。通过官方手册中的示例代码,你可以看到各种实际应用场景,从而激发学习兴趣。

 2. 通过需求驱动学习

学习过程中,可以根据自己的需求,查找手册中的对应功能和示例代码。例如,如果需要实现某个特殊功能,可以在手册中查找相关的脚本案例,进行参考和修改,直到实现自己的需求。

5.png

例实践:实现一个综合应用

通过一个综合案例,可以更好地理解和掌握WinCC脚本功能。下面是一个基于以上功能的综合案例:

 1. 功能描述

该案例实现以下功能:

- 读取温度传感器数据并显示在界面上。

- 根据温度值进行报警控制。

- 将温度数据记录到Excel文件中。

- 读取Excel文件中的阈值配置参数。

2. 代码实现

6.png

总结

通过以上两种方法,你可以快速掌握WinCC的脚本功能。第一种方法是从高频功能入手,通过实际操作逐个复现常用功能,形成自己的知识体系;第二种方法是借助官方手册,通过需求驱动学习,实现自己的定制功能。结合这两种方法,你不仅可以快速上手,还能深入理解和灵活应用WinCC的脚本功能,提升系统的自动化水平和效率。

此外,学习过程中要注意以下几点:

1. 多动手实践:理论知识只有通过实践才能真正掌握,多编写和调试脚本可以加深理解。

2. 不断总结经验:在实际项目中总结经验,逐步提高脚本编写的技巧和效率。

3. 积极交流学习:通过论坛、技术群组等途径,与其他用户交流经验,学习他人的优秀做法。

审核编辑(
王静
)
投诉建议

提交

查看更多评论
其他资讯

查看更多

派拓网络被Forrester评为XDR领域领导者

展会|Lubeworks路博流体供料系统精彩亮相AMTS展会

中国联通首个量子通信产品“量子密信”亮相!

国家重大装备企业齐聚高交会 中国科技第一展11月深圳举行

东土精彩亮相华南工博会,展现未来工业前沿技术